    SSC GD Constable Admit Card 2026: Security Measures for 25,487 Posts

    To ensure a fair selection process, SSC has introduced AI-based facial recognition for the 2026 exams. When a candidate reaches the centre, their face will be scanned and matched with the photo on their SSC GD Admit Card 2026 and the OTR database.

  • Apr 22, 2026, 14:39 IST

    SSC GD Admit Card 2026: Expected Number of Applicants

    RTI data reveals that over 48.83 lakh candidates have applied for the 25,487 SSC GD vacancies this year. This makes the 2026 cycle one of the most competitive in recent history, with roughly 191 candidates competing for a single post. The high applicant count is the reason why the SSC GD Admit Card 2026 is being released in four windows.

    SSC GD Constable Admit Card 2026: Language Selection in CBT

    SSC has emphasised that the choice of language (English/Hindi) for the fourth section must be made at the time of the exam, not during registration. The SSC GD Admit Card 2026 will show the overall exam as bilingual, but once the candidate sits for the test, they must select their preferred language for the 20-question language section.

  • Apr 22, 2026, 13:46 IST

    SSC GD Constable Admit Card 2026: Handling Mismatched Photographs

    In cases where the photograph on the SSC GD Admit Card 2026 appears blurred or belongs to someone else, candidates must take immediate corrective steps. Since the correction window is closed, candidates must carry two identical passport-size photos that they used during registration to the exam centre.

  • Apr 22, 2026, 13:16 IST

    SSC GD Admit Card 2026: Is a wrinkled or torn hall ticket valid?

    The SSC GD Admit Card 2026 is the most important document that a candidate must carry to the examination centre. Candidates often worry whether a wrinkled or slightly torn hall ticket will be considered valid or not. Minor folds or wrinkles that do not affect readability are generally acceptable, but any major tear where information becomes unreadable will not be accepted.

    SSC GD Constable Exam 2026: City Slip vs. Admit Card

    In the SSC GD Exam 2026 candidates often get confused with the city intimation slip and admit card. Both documents serve different purposes; the SSC GD City Slip gets released 10 days before the exam to inform candidates about the city of examination, while the admit card gets released 2-3 days before the exam and is the official document required to be carried to the examination centre.

    SSC GD Admit Card 2026: Negative Marking Clarification

    As the candidate is waiting for the hall ticket, candidates must remember the updated marking scheme. For every incorrect response, 0.50 marks will be deducted. The admit card will also carry a set of instructions regarding the Computer-Based Test interface.

  • Apr 22, 2026, 12:22 IST

    SSC GD Constable Admit Card 2026: Reporting to the Correct Centre

    The City Intimation Slip released on April 19 only provided the name of the city. The actual SSC GD Admit Card 2026 will contain the specific name of the exam centre, along with a landmark. Candidates are advised to visit the centre location a day in advance if they are unfamiliar with the area.

  • Apr 22, 2026, 12:15 IST

    SSC GD Admit Card 2026: Photo ID Verification Rules

    A common reason for candidate disqualification at the gate is a mismatch in the Date of Birth (DOB). The SSC GD Admit Card 2026 must have the same DOB as per the Aadhaar Card or PAN Card of the candidate. If the ID does not have the complete DOB (Date, Month, and Year), candidates must carry an additional original certificate (like a Class 10 Marksheet) as proof

  • Apr 22, 2026, 12:07 IST

    SSC GD Constable Admit Card 2026: Shift Timings Revealed

    The detailed admit card will confirm the specific shift timing. The SSC GD exam is generally conducted in three shifts:

    Morning (9:00 AM – 10:00 AM)

    Afternoon (12:30 PM – 1:30 PM)

    Evening (4:00 PM – 5:00 PM)

    The reporting time is usually 90 minutes before the commencement of the exam.

SSC GD Exam Schedule 2026

The SSC GD exam is scheduled to be conducted in four distinct windows. Check the details below

  • Window 1: April 27 – May 2, 2026

  • Window 2: May 4 – May 9, 2026

  • Window 3: May 18 – May 23, 2026

  • Window 4: May 25 – May 30, 2026

If the exam of the candidate falls in Window 1, then the admit card can be released between April 23 and April 24, 2026.
